Oscar-nommed Toni Collette joins “xXx3” action pic

Toni Collette is joining the ever-growing cast of xXx3: The Return of Xander Cage, the Vin Diesel-starring reboot of the 2002 action pic, The Hollywood Reporter reveals.

The project is gearing up for a production start in February and already has a call sheet that includes Tony Jaa, Jet Li, Vampire Diaries' Nina Dobrev, Bollywood star Deepika Padukone and Orange Is the New Black breakout Ruby Rose as well as Samuel L. Jackson.

D.J. Caruso is directing the pic, which has a script by F. Scott Frazier, and plans on shooting in Toronto and the Dominican Republic.

Plot details are being kept under wraps but insiders say it involves two teams of badasses that go head-to-head.

Collette will play a bureaucrat in the intelligence service.

Joe Roth and Jeff Kirschenbaum are producing xXx3 along with Diesel and Samantha Vincent. Vince Totino and Scott Hemming of Revolution Studios, which was rebooted two years when it was bought by hedge fund Fortress, are shepherding actor and distributor deals for the film.

Collette, who was nominated for an Oscar for her work in The Sixth Sense, was one of the stars of the Christmas horror comedy Krampus and is part of the ensemble of Iraq war drama The Yellow Birds with Jennifer Aniston and Jack Huston.
